What Is a Crane Accident Lawyer Handle?

A crane accident lawyer is a premises liability attorney who specializes in claims arising from crane collapses and worksite incidents. Unlike a standard personal injury practitioner, a crane accident lawyer has in-depth knowledge of the federal guidelines that regulate crane operation, as well as the technical concepts that determine when a crane breaks down.

Mechanically, the service of a crane accident lawyer involves collecting documentation from the incident location, retaining expert safety specialists to analyze the collapse, reviewing operator certifications, and determining every person whose carelessness played a role to your injuries. This methodology is far more complex than a standard slip-and-fall case.

Your crane accident lawyer also handles dealings with adjusters, prepares demand packages that capture the true extent of your damages, and takes your case to litigation if a just resolution cannot be secured. The Crane Accident Lawyer Procedure Step by Step

  1. Your First Consultation

    Your journey begins with a no-cost consultation with a crane accident lawyer. During this session, you explain the details of your incident, and the attorney evaluates responsibility, available compensation, and the merit of your case.

  2. Collecting Critical Evidence

    The law firm quickly dispatches investigators to photograph the job site. Inspection records, crane specifications, and co-worker interviews are all gathered before evidence can be lost.

  3. Liability Analysis and Party Identification

    Your crane accident lawyer consults safety specialists to establish the exact cause of the failure. More than one person or company may share fault — contractors — and all must be identified.

  4. Preparing the Compensation Claim

    Once liability is determined, your attorney calculates every applicable damages — current and future treatment costs, lost earning capacity, recovery costs, and non-economic losses. This documentation forms the foundation of negotiations.

  5. Reaching a Fair Resolution

    Your crane accident lawyer presents the demand letter to responsible parties and pushes hard for a full settlement. Most crane accident cases settle at this stage, but your attorney is always ready to proceed if needed.

  6. Preparing for Trial

    If defense teams decline to provide a reasonable amount, your crane accident lawyer takes legal action and develops a comprehensive litigation plan. Discovery reinforces your claim throughout this process.

  7. Receiving Your Compensation

    Whether your case settles or goes to trial, your crane accident lawyer makes sure payment are accurately disbursed, liens are resolved, and you understand every element of your compensation.

Can I sue if I already received workers' compensation for my crane injury?

Yes. Workers' compensation covers only part of your real costs. A crane accident lawyer can simultaneously pursue a third-party claim against equipment manufacturers or other outside parties whose negligence caused your accident. These civil damages frequently go far beyond workers' comp benefits.

How long do I have to contact a crane accident lawyer after my injury?

Nevada's legal time limit for personal injury cases is typically two years from the incident date. Missing this deadline can permanently bar your option to file compensation. This is why reaching out to a crane accident lawyer right away after an injury is essential.
